| - Altogether eight species have been found or recorded in the study area (= 47.1 % of the total Czech fauna). Most species found are broadly distributed with Holarctic or even broader range (5 species; 62.5 %), a smaller proportion of species have Temperate and North European distribution (2; 25 %), a single species is Palaearctic (12.5 %). Pseudoseps signata is recorded here for the first time from Moravia and the species is included as an endangered species in the recent Red list (BARTÁK 2005). The most frequent species in Podyjí NP was P. vulgaris found in eight samples and it is probably the most common species of the family in our country. The localities with the most diverse piophilid species spectrum seem to be Liščí skála and Čížovský rybník (4 species each).
